At the Ballon d’Or ceremony last night, Sir Alex Ferguson was presented with the FIFA presidential award for services to football. Ferguson claimed he was lucky to have managed so many great players who have helped him achieve the success he’s had. “It is an honour for me in the twilight of my life and [...]

Fergie: Linesman Could Have Cost Us The Title
Sir Alex Ferguson has slammed the assistant referee, John Flynn, after a ridiculous decision which denied United three points against Newcastle today. The referee, Mike Jones, initially indicated that a corner should be awarded, before the linesman flagged for a penalty. Ferguson criticised the linesman and reflected on an equally poor decision by an official [...]
